PHOTO UPDATE: Chamber of Commerce chooses new president

TERRE HAUTE — Ken Brengle has been selected as the new president and chief executive officer of the Terre Haute Chamber of Commerce. The announcement of Brengle’s hiring came at a morning news conference today.

He will begin his new duties May 15.

Brengle is an experienced chamber of commerce and economic development executive and consultant, according to a Chamber news release. His career spans more than 30 years, with more than 20 of those spent as a chief executive officer (CEO).

The search began last summer and used a search firm.

Norm Lowery, Chamber board chairman, said that “Ken brings extensive Chamber professional experience and success that will prove invaluable. I would also like to thank the search committee for their commitment and dedication to successfully recruit a person of Ken’s caliber to lead the Chamber going forward.”

Bob Quatroche, interim Chamber president, will work directly with Ken Brengle to ensure a smooth transition over the next several weeks, Lowery said.

Brengle said he is “excited and pleased to become a part of the Chamber’s leadership team, particularly at a time when the Wabash Valley and Terre Haute are entering a new era in its history. My family and I looking forward to being part of the community and making Terre Haute our home.”

He previously served as CEO for the West Chamber of Commerce in Jefferson County, Colorado, a market of 250,000.

He also was the executive of the Big Bear Lake (California) Resort Association, where he facilitated the design of, assembled funding for and managed a $1.5 million marketing campaign.

As president/CEO of the Montrose (Colorado) Association of Commerce & Tourism, he directed the initiation of a multi-county “buy local” campaign.

He has maintained a consulting practice throughout his career.

In addition, Brengle has served as the CEO of Chambers of Commerce in Cheyenne, Wyo.; Durango, Colo.; Torrance, Calif., and Cortez, Colo.

He held staff positions as vice president for marketing and membership for the $6 million-in-budget Pensacola (Florida) Chamber; as assistant manager of the Fort Collins (Colorado) Chamber; and as vice president-investor relations for the Adams County (Colo.) Economic Development Corporation.

He is one of only 200 active Certified Chamber Executives (CCE) in the U.S.

Brengle is married and has a 12-year-old son and three adult children. He enjoys golf, Scouting and biking.
